Don't worry it's not going to hit Earth, but this Asteroid will be flying close to Earth next weekend. According to the NY Post, the asteroid is named "Asteroid 2006 QQ23" and it's larger than the Empire State Building with an estimated diameter of nearly 1,900 feet. So that's a pretty large space rock that will be flying by us next week.

"Asteroid 2006 QQ23" is going to pass relatively close to Earth on August 10. Now by close NASA means it will come within about 5 million miles. Five million miles might seem like its really far, but this Asteroid is quite large, and any large asteroid making a fly-by is going to draw scientists to look more into it. In addition, NASA scientists also say these fly-bys are common with asteroids the size of this one passing by the Earth roughly half a dozen times a year.
